数据库事务恢复处于
数据库事务恢复处于关键阶段,如何高效解决数据恢复难题?
信息技术的飞速发展,数据库已经成为企业核心竞争力的关键。然而,数据库事故和数据丢失的风险也随之增加。当数据库事务恢复处于关键阶段时,如何高效解决数据恢复难题成为企业关注的焦点。本文将围绕数据库事务恢复、数据恢复方法以及数据恢复策略等方面展开论述。

一、数据库事务恢复
数据库事务恢复是指在数据库发生故障后,通过一系列操作使数据库恢复到一致状态的过程。数据库事务恢复通常包括以下步骤:
1. 检测故障:当数据库出现故障时,系统会自动检测并发出警报。
2. 保存检查点:在检测到故障之前,系统会自动保存一个检查点,以便在恢复过程中快速定位故障点。
3. 恢复数据:根据检查点信息,系统从备份中恢复数据。
4. 恢复事务日志:系统读取事务日志,将已提交的事务应用到恢复后的数据上。
5. 检查一致性:在恢复过程中,系统会检查数据的一致性,确保恢复后的数据库处于一致状态。
二、数据恢复方法

1. 备份恢复:备份恢复是数据恢复中最常用的方法,包括全备份、增量备份和差异备份等。全备份是指备份整个数据库,增量备份只备份自上次备份以来发生变化的数据,差异备份则备份自上次全备份以来发生变化的数据。
2. 逻辑恢复:逻辑恢复是指通过SQL语句或其他工具恢复数据。逻辑恢复通常适用于恢复特定数据或表。
3. 物理恢复:物理恢复是指通过直接操作数据库文件恢复数据。物理恢复适用于恢复大量数据或恢复速度要求较高的场景。
4. 第三方工具恢复:第三方工具恢复是指使用第三方数据恢复软件恢复数据。这些工具通常具有强大的功能和便捷的操作界面。
三、数据恢复策略
1. 定期备份:定期备份是预防数据丢失的重要手段。企业应根据业务需求制定合理的备份计划,确保数据安全。
2. 异地备份:异地备份是指将备份存储在远离主数据库的位置。当主数据库发生故障时,可以迅速从异地备份恢复数据。
3. 备份验证:定期验证备份的有效性,确保在发生故障时能够成功恢复数据。
4. 备份加密:对备份进行加密,防止数据泄露。
5. 备份自动化:采用自动化备份工具,提高备份效率,降低人工操作错误。
6. 增量备份与差异备份相结合:根据业务需求,合理配置增量备份和差异备份,降低备份存储空间和恢复时间。
7. 备份策略根据业务变化,不断优化备份策略,提高数据恢复效率。

数据库事务恢复处于关键阶段时,企业应采取有效措施确保数据安全。通过制定合理的备份策略、选择合适的数据恢复方法,以及采取有效的数据恢复措施,企业可以最大限度地降低数据丢失的风险,确保业务连续性。在实际操作中,企业还需关注备份存储、备份验证、备份加密等方面,确保数据恢复工作的顺利进行。